MERCEDES-BENZ C CLASS COUPE (2011-16) C180 2DR COUPE 1.6 SS 156 EU6 AMG SPORT EDITION MAP PILOT 6SPD

The MERCEDES-BENZ C CLASS COUPE (2011-16) C180 2DR COUPE 1.6 SS 156 EU6 AMG SPORT EDITION MAP PILOT 6SPD is a stylish and sleek luxury coupe that appeals to drivers seeking a combination of sporty looks and premium comfort. As part of the well-regarded Mercedes-Benz C-Class family, this coupe stands out in the UK's used car market for its sophisticated design and refined driving experience. Typically used by those who want a more dynamic and stylish vehicle than a traditional saloon, it's popular among professionals, young drivers, and those seeking a car that blends everyday usability with sporty flair. What makes this vehicle particularly notable are its standout features, such as the AMG Sport trim, which adds sporty styling touches and improved handling, along with advanced features like the Map Pilot navigation system. Its 1.6-litre engine offers a good balance of performance and fuel economy, making it suitable for daily commuting and longer trips alike. Known for reliability and comfort, the Mercedes-Benz C180 coupe also benefits from a reputation of high-quality build and a smooth drive compared to many rivals in its class. With an average recorded mileage of around 74,719 miles and typically up to two previous owners, the C-Class Coupe (2011-16) C180 remains a popular choice for drivers seeking a stylish, dependable, and well-equipped used car in the UK market.

The data indicates that the most recent mileage readings for the Mercedes-Benz C-Class Coupe (2011-16) model predominantly cluster in the 60,000 to 70,000-mile range, representing 16% of recordings. Notably, there's also a significant proportion—12%—of vehicles with mileage in the 80,000 to 90,000, 90,000 to 100,000, and 100,000 to 110,000-mile ranges, suggesting these models often reach higher mileages. Conversely, lower mileages, such as under 10,000 miles, are rare (only 4%), and there's a small percentage (4%) of vehicles recorded with over 130,000 miles. Overall, most vehicles tend to fall within the 50,000 to 70,000-mile range, indicating typical usage patterns for cars of this age and model.

The data indicates that the majority of private sale valuations for the specified Mercedes-Benz C-Class Coupe (2011-16) models fall within the £5,000 to £7,000 range, accounting for 20% of the valuations. The most common price bracket is £6,000 to £7,000, representing 28%. Interestingly, a significant proportion of the valuations (around 12%) are clustered in the £9,000 to £10,000 and £10,000 to £11,000 ranges, suggesting some vehicles may be valued higher possibly due to factors like condition, specifications, or optional features. The lower end of the spectrum (below £6,000) appears less common, comprising 20% of the valuations, which might reflect the overall market positioning and desirability of these vehicles within that age and model range.

The data indicates that for the 2011-2016 Mercedes-Benz C-Class Coupe (C180 2DR Coupe 1.6 SS 156 EU6 AMG Sport Edition Map Pilot 6SPD), the main paint colours are quite evenly distributed between black and white, each accounting for 36% of the sample. Silver is less common at 12%, and red is used in 16% of vehicles. Overall, black and white are the most popular colour choices, suggesting a preference for classic and neutral tones among owners of this model.

The data indicates that for the Mercedes-Benz C Class Coupe (2011-16) C180 2DR model, the majority of vehicles have had either 3 or 4 registered keepers. Specifically, 48% of the vehicles have had 3 keepers, and 20% have had 4 keepers. Together, these two categories account for 68% of the vehicles. Additionally, 20% of the vehicles have had 5 keepers, while only a small proportion, 12%, have had just 2 keepers. This distribution suggests that most of these vehicles tend to change hands multiple times, with very few remaining with only 2 registered keepers, and a notable concentration at the 3-keeper mark.

The data indicates that all vehicles of the specified model, the Mercedes-Benz C-Class Coupe (2011-16) C180 2DR Coupe 1.6 SS AMG Sport Edition with Map Pilot, are equipped with a 1.595-litre engine capacity and primarily run on petrol. This uniformity suggests that within this model and specification, there is consistent engine and fuel type, which could be useful for buyers or insurers seeking specific technical details.
